DTDC stands for Delhi Tourism Development Corporation DTDC stands for Desk to Desk Courier & Cargo Ltd DTDC stands for…
DTDC stands for Delhi Tourism Development Corporation DTDC stands for Desk to Desk Courier & Cargo Ltd DTDC stands for…
DTDD stands for Dynamiques des Territoires et Développement Durable (French: Dynamic of Territories and Sustainable Development) DTDD stands for Directorate…